Output 28fc6d2dc8815c76fbc938d0224ac26f32b3c5c3adf3c71566a00ceb0bb4fe8e:1

value
1057624
script pubkey
OP_0 OP_PUSHBYTES_20 921eafd20a13d673d7511a7a7b2e657eb3ccaedc
address
bc1qjg02l5s2z0t88463rfa8ktn906euetkuncu03f
transaction
28fc6d2dc8815c76fbc938d0224ac26f32b3c5c3adf3c71566a00ceb0bb4fe8e
confirmations
189706
spent
true